Transaction 953aadbe14876ebd8f0c33db39ff424301dbd1059b83f15182d89a79bc537463
1 Input
2 Outputs
- 953aadbe14876ebd8f0c33db39ff424301dbd1059b83f15182d89a79bc537463:0
- 953aadbe14876ebd8f0c33db39ff424301dbd1059b83f15182d89a79bc537463:1
value 29000
address 3NEwtfCF1kKpSBgdWNMuHGD6S3pye66MH5
value 50888
address 16cBFxg4DTdU6cwh2eQkjEctD9SesFZixE